Understanding Self-Love: More Than Just Bubble Baths
Before we dive into the ‘how,’ let’s clarify the ‘what.’ Self-love is often misunderstood, sometimes dismissed as selfish or superficial. But true self-love is far from it. It’s an active state of appreciation for one’s own worth, a deep regard for your happiness and well-being. It involves:
- Self-Acceptance: Acknowledging and embracing all parts of yourself – the strengths, the quirks, and even the perceived flaws – without judgment.
- Self-Respect: Honoring your values, setting healthy boundaries, and treating yourself with dignity.
- Self-Care: Actively engaging in practices that promote your physical, mental, emotional, and spiritual health.
- Self-Compassion: Treating yourself with kindness and understanding, especially during times of failure or suffering, just as you would a dear friend.
Research consistently highlights the profound impact of self-love on overall well-being. Studies published in journals like Psychological Science demonstrate that individuals with higher levels of self-compassion, a core component of self-love, exhibit greater emotional resilience, less anxiety and depression, and improved relationships. It’s the bedrock upon which genuine happiness and healthy interactions with the world are built. Think of it as your inner anchor, keeping you steady amidst life’s storms.
Cultivating Self-Awareness: The Foundation of Love
You can’t truly love what you don’t know. Self-awareness is the crucial first step on your self-love journey, providing the insights needed to understand your needs, desires, and patterns. It’s like shining a gentle spotlight on your inner world.
Practical Steps to Boost Self-Awareness:
- Mindful Check-Ins: Throughout your day, pause for a moment. Ask yourself: “What am I feeling right now? Where do I feel it in my body? What thought is occupying my mind?” This simple practice, often called a “body scan” or “mindful pause,” helps you connect with your present experience. Research on mindfulness, a practice rooted in ancient traditions and now widely studied, shows it can literally rewire your brain to increase emotional regulation and self-insight.
- Journaling for Discovery: Dedicate 10-15 minutes daily to free-form writing. Don’t edit or judge; just let your thoughts flow onto the page. You can use prompts like:
- “What brought me joy today?”
- “What challenges did I face, and how did I react?”
- “What do I truly need more of (or less of) in my life right now?”
- “What values are most important to me, and am I living in alignment with them?”
Journaling helps you identify recurring patterns, process emotions, and gain clarity on your authentic self.
- Identify Your Core Values: What principles guide your life? Is it kindness, creativity, integrity, adventure, security? Knowing your values helps you make decisions that resonate with your true self, fostering a deeper sense of purpose and self-respect. When you act in alignment with your values, you reinforce your self-worth.
By regularly practicing self-awareness, you build a clearer picture of who you are, what you need, and what truly matters to you, laying a strong foundation for genuine self-love.
Nourishing Your Body & Mind: A Holistic Approach
Your body is your temple, and your mind is its sacred space. Neglecting either makes true self-love difficult. A holistic approach acknowledges the interconnectedness of your physical and mental well-being.
Evidence-Based Nourishment Strategies:
- Mindful Movement: Instead of viewing exercise as a punishment, embrace movement as a celebration of what your body can do. Whether it’s dancing to reggae beats, a brisk walk in nature, yoga, or swimming, find activities that bring you joy. Physical activity releases endorphins, natural mood boosters, and reduces stress hormones like cortisol. The American Heart Association consistently recommends regular physical activity for both physical and mental health.
- Fueling Your Body with Intention: Pay attention to what you eat and how it makes you feel. Focus on whole, unprocessed foods rich in nutrients. Hydrate adequately. Mindful eating—slowing down, savoring flavors, and listening to your body’s hunger and fullness cues—can transform your relationship with food from one of guilt to one of loving care. Research shows a strong link between gut health (influenced by diet) and mental well-being, often referred to as the “gut-brain axis.”
